Zaheer Iqbal, who is making his Bollywood debut with Salman Khan's production Notebook, says there is a pressure to not disappoint the superstar

Salman Khan and Zaheer Iqbal
Zaheer Iqbal, who stars in the film alongside Mohnish Bahl's daughter Pranutan, says even though Salman's name is attached to the project, their performances in the movie will decide their fate. "I know about the pros and cons and the pressure of being launched by Salman Khan. I know what people will say. There is a pressure to not let him (Salman) down," Zaheer told PTI.
"He told me that his name is associated with film and therefore the film will be screened at the 12 pm or 3 pm slots at the theatres but after that the film will ride on us and its story. So we know that few people might come to watch because of him," he adds. Since his childhood, Zaheer has been catching up on almost every film and his love for cinema grew further during his college days when he used to actively participate in theatre and other creative activities.
